Diagnostics tool to investigate rare issue where the Cavium Nitrox PX/III crypto chip gets into a "request queue stuck" situation.
This tool enables F5 engineers to obtain more data about this problem to help diagnose the issue.
System with Cavium Nitrox PX/III chip(s) which includes the BIG-IP 5xxx, 7xxx, 10xxx, and 12xxx platforms as well as the VIPRIOn B2200 blade, that hits a rare issue which logs a "request queue stuck" message in /var/log/ltm.
None.
Provides a diagnostics tool. Does not directly mitigate the problem.
